Rock Splitters, Quarry
Boilermakers
| Attribute | Rock Splitters, Quarry | Boilermakers |
|---|---|---|
| Career area | Construction & Extraction | Construction & Extraction |
| What it involves | Separate blocks of rough dimension stone from quarry mass using jackhammers, wedges, or chop saws. | Construct, assemble, maintain, and repair stationary steam boilers and boiler house auxiliaries. |
